Background
Radjai, Alireza was born on September 10, 1956 in Shiraz, Fars, Iran. Son of Abdolnabi Radjai and Roghaieh Attar.

Bachelor of Science in Materials science and Engineering, Shiraz University, Iran, 1980. Master of Science in Iron and Steel Engineering, Nagoya University, Japan, 1984. Doctor of Philosophy in Iron and Steel Engineering, Nagoya University, Japan, 1987.
Research associate Nagoya University, Japan, 1987—1990. Assistant professor Shiraz University, Iran, 1994—1996. Advanced materials processing research scientist National Industrial Research Institute of Nagoya (New Energy and Industrial Technology Development Organization), Nagoya, Japan, 1996—1997.
Senior research scientist National Industrial Research Institute of Nagoya (Japan Science and Technology Corporation), Japan, 1998—2002. Research scientist, lecturer Shiraz, Isfahan, Ahwaz,, Iran, since 2002. Consultant Kobe Steel Company, Japan, 1990—1992.
Joint research for studying the effects of electomagnetic vibrations on pure copper Sumitomo Electric Industries, Osaka Laboratories, Japan, 2000—2002. Joint research for investigating novel applications of glass Ishizuka Glass Company, Nagoya, Aichi Prefecture, Japan, 2000—2002. Joint research for improving the properties of aluminum automobile parts by using cavitation phenomenon Aishin Takaoka Company, Toyota, Aichi Prefecture, Japan, 2000—2002.
Goodwill ambassador Nagoya International Center, Japan, 1993—1994. Member of Minerals, Metals and Materials Society.
Married Kyoko Yamada, August 13, 1985. 1 child Leyla.
